What's Happening?
The Paxton-Buckley-Loda (PBL) varsity volleyball team experienced a close defeat against Tri-Valley, with scores of 25-19 and 26-24. Key players for PBL included Emmy Bagwell, who contributed six kills and three blocks, and Logan Loschen, who provided 15 assists and one ace. Hallee Johnson added six digs to the team's efforts, while Rowan Caposieno and Kyleigh Williams each scored one ace. The junior varsity team also faced a loss, with scores of 25-16 and 25-21 against Tri-Valley.
